False Creek

Description
In this masterful collection, Griffin Poetry Prize winner Jane Munro balances her signature themes--dream life, the visual arts, the mysteries of the natural world--with an urgent, more directly political voice. While not shirking painful realities, the poems support the human capacity to climb ladders, arrive at fresh points of view, listen to one another, and greet despair with attention, wit--and hope.
